> > We've been making pretty steady progress over the last few releases.
> > I'd suggest that a bump to 7.0 should happen when we've accumulated
> > most of the fixes/improvements from the "hot list". We've worked
> > through most of those; here are the ones I'd like to see at or before
> > a 7.0 release:
> > 
> > o implement outer joins
> > o merge date/time types and deprecate the old 4-byte ones
> 
> My opinion is that MVCC should have jump'd us to 7.0 in the first
> place...
> 
> IMHO, release for October should be v7.0 ... if the above two get done,
> great, if not, no probs...

Due to overwhelming agreement, it is 6.6.  I personally vote for 7.0,
and so do you, but we are outnumbered.  We can revisit this as the
release gets closer, but to change it then, I am going to have to change
PG_VERSION, and that will require initdb for everyone.  Perhaps just
before we enter beta, we can discuss it, knowing then what our features
will be.
